According to the research study, in 2013, the global market for broadcast switchers was valued at US1.3 bn and is estimated to reach a value of US$2 bn by the end of 2020, exhibiting a progressive 6.70% CAGR between 2014 and 2020.

Among the different types of video resolution, in 2013, the HD segment accounted for a massive share of 75% in the global broadcast switchers market. The growing preference for HD is estimated to affect the SD segment negatively in the forecast period. By application, the global market for broadcast switchers has been classified into studio production, post-production, news production, sports broadcasting, production trucks, and others such as places of worship, educational institutes, corporate conferences, play outs, and live events. Among these segments, in 2013, the studio production application segment held a share of 25% in the global market and is projected to continue with its leading position throughout the forecast period.
The research report has segmented the global broadcast switchers market on the basis of geography into Asia Pacific, North America, Europe, and Rest of the World. Among all these regions, in 2013, North America accounted for a dominant share of 40.5% in the global market for broadcast switchers. The high growth of this region is due to the rising adoption of low-end routing switchers and rapid expansion of the sports broadcasting, studio production, and automotive segments. Moreover, the rising number of HD channels and growing emphasis on production automation in the U.S. are some of the other factors propelling the switchers market in North America. The Asia Pacific and Rest of the World markets are also projected to witness robust growth thanks to the shift from analog to digital broadcasting in these regions.

The prominent players operating in the global market for high-end, mid-end, and low-end broadcast switchers are New Tek Inc., Grass Valley USA LLC, Snell Ltd., For A Company, Ross Video, Blackmagic Design, Panasonic Corporation, Sony Electronics Inc., Broadcast Pix, and Evertz Corporation. The major switcher manufacturers across the globe are competing by improving their state-of-the-art products and services to get the competitive advantage in the global market.
